2-isopropyl-1,4-butanediol | 39497-66-0

中文名称
——
中文别名
——
英文名称
2-isopropyl-1,4-butanediol
英文别名
2-propan-2-ylbutane-1,4-diol
2-isopropyl-1,4-butanediol化学式
CAS
39497-66-0
化学式
C7H16O2
mdl
——
分子量
132.203
InChiKey
XWFCJSXTVSOIDN-UHFFFAOYSA-N
BEILSTEIN
——
EINECS
——

物化性质

  • 熔点:
    44.24°C (estimate)
  • 沸点:
    233.16°C (rough estimate)
  • 密度:
    0.9744 (rough estimate)

计算性质

  • 辛醇/水分配系数(LogP):
    0.8
  • 重原子数:
    9
  • 可旋转键数:
    4
  • 环数:
    0.0
  • sp3杂化的碳原子比例:
    1.0
  • 拓扑面积:
    40.5
  • 氢给体数:
    2
  • 氢受体数:
    2

反应信息

  • 作为反应物:
    描述:
    2-isopropyl-1,4-butanediol 在 bis[dichloro(pentamethylcyclopentadienyl)iridium(III)] 、 cesium bicarbonate环戊基甲醚 作用下, 以 甲苯 为溶剂, 反应 26.0h, 生成 benzyl 3-isopropylpyrrolidine-1-carboxylate
    参考文献:
    名称:
    A hydrogen borrowing annulation strategy for the stereocontrolled synthesis of saturated aza-heterocycles
    摘要:
    一种氢借位缩合策略实现了C2、C3和C4取代饱和氮杂环的立体控制合成。
    DOI:
    10.1039/d0cc00903b
  • 作为产物:
    描述:
    二乙基异亚丙基琥珀酸酯 在 palladium on activated charcoal 、 lithium aluminium tetrahydride 、 乙醚乙醇 作用下, 生成 2-isopropyl-1,4-butanediol
    参考文献:
    名称:
    Overberger; Roberts, Journal of the American Chemical Society, 1949, vol. 71, p. 3621

  • Catalytic regioselective dehydrogenation of unsymmetrical α,ω-diols using ruthenium complexes
    作者:Youichi Ishii、Kohtaro Osakada、Takao Ikariya、Masahiko Saburi、Sadao Yoshikawa
    DOI:10.1016/s0040-4039(00)87975-7
    日期:——
    Ruthenium complex catalyzed regioselective dehydrogenation of unsymmetrically substituted 1,4- and 1,5-diols in the presence of α,β-unsaturated ketone as a hydrogen acceptor and triethylamine gave β-substituted γ-lactones and γ-substituted δ-lactones as major products, respectively.
    在α,β-不饱和酮作为氢受体和三乙胺的存在下,钌络合物催化不对称取代的1,4-和1,5-二醇的区域选择性脱氢,主要生成β-取代的γ-内酯和γ-取代的δ-内酯产品。
